Preparing a niche and checking the dimensions

The first and most important stage is a thorough check of the furniture niche. Even if the kitchen was custom-made, human error or material shrinkage could make adjustments. You need to arm yourself with a tape measure and a level to measure the height, width and depth of the free space. Dimensions of the niche Must strictly comply with the technical data sheet of the refrigerator, including the necessary technological clearances for air circulation.

Pay special attention to the ventilation system. In most modern models, air is drawn in through the bottom grille (base) and exits through the top of the cabinet. Make sure the furniture has appropriate holes or slots. If you are using an old headset, the design may need to be modified to ensure proper airflow.

⚠️ Attention: Lack of sufficient air flow will lead to rapid failure of the compressor and void the manufacturer's warranty.

Also check the evenness of the floor and walls of the niche. If the cabinet is skewed, the refrigerator doors may not close tightly or may open spontaneously. Use a building level for diagnosis. If necessary, place shims or wedges under the furniture legs to level the structure before installing the equipment.

Special attention should be paid to fastening elements. Self-tapping screws are often included with the refrigerator, but their length or type of head may not be suitable for your furniture. For example, to attach the facade to the refrigerator door, you may need special screws included in the kit, and to install the appliance itself in a niche, you may need dowels or furniture screws.

It is important to have it on hand template for drillingif it is provided by the manufacturer. Some brands, such as Bosch or Siemens, include paper or cardboard stencils, which greatly simplify marking the holes for the facade hinges. The use of such templates minimizes the risk of errors when drilling an expensive furniture panel.

Transportation and initial installation in a niche

After unpacking and removing all shipping materials (films, foam plastic, tape), the stage of physical installation of the unit begins. Remember that built-in refrigerators are often heavy, so it is better to perform this operation together. It is strictly forbidden to carry equipment by holding it by the door or plastic strapping elements.

Carefully push the refrigerator body into the prepared niche, leaving a small margin in front for connection and adjustment. At this stage, it is important not to damage the side walls of the furniture. If the floor is slippery, place a piece of thick cardboard or linoleum under the legs of the unit to make it easier to position the device.

Make sure that the power cord is not pinched or tensioned. Electrical cable should freely extend from the back of the niche to the socket. The socket should be located in an accessible place, preferably on the side of a niche or in an adjacent cabinet, in order to be able to turn off the device without completely removing it.

⚠️ Attention: Do not connect the refrigerator to the network immediately after transportation if it was transported lying down. Allow the oil in the compressor to drain into the crankcase (from 2 to 24 hours depending on the position during transportation).

Fixing the refrigerator in a furniture box

Fixing the body in a niche is a critical point that ensures stable operation. Most models are mounted through the top of the cabinet or through special holes in the side walls of the refrigerator body. Use only those fastening points that are specified in the instructions for your model.

The fastening method through the top cover of the cabinet is often used. To do this, holes are drilled in the furniture lid through which the refrigerator body brackets are screwed with self-tapping screws. This prevents the equipment from falling forward. In some cases, it is necessary to secure the unit on the sides to prevent vibration.

Nuances of fastening in tall cabinets

If the refrigerator is installed in a column with a height of more than 2 meters, it is recommended to use additional spacers or stiffeners in the upper part of the cabinet so that the structure does not deform under the weight of the equipment and the facade.

During operation with fasteners, be careful: a self-tapping screw that is too long can damage the internal cooling circuit or damage the decorative panel. Drilling depth must be strictly controlled. If you doubt the thickness of the material, it is better to use a depth stop on a drill or screwdriver.

After fixing, try to slightly rock the body. He should be sitting there dead. Any movement is unacceptable, as it will be transmitted to the front doors and can lead to their loosening over time. If there is any play, use additional spacers or adjusting screws in the legs.

Installation of facade panels and doors

This is the most difficult and important stage that determines the appearance of your kitchen. The front panel must be perfectly aligned with adjacent cabinets. For fastening, special brackets are used, which are first mounted on the refrigerator door, and then the furniture facade is attached to them.

The process is as follows:

1. Install the mounting brackets on the refrigerator door according to the diagram in the instructions.

2. Try on the front panel, checking the alignment of the holes.

3. Secure the panel to the brackets using screws.

4. Adjust the position of the front using the screws on the hinges.

Adjusting the hinges allows you to set the gaps between the refrigerator doors and adjacent cabinets, as well as ensure a tight fit. Modern hinges, such as systems Blum or Hettich, allow you to adjust the position in three planes: height, depth and horizontal. This makes it possible to eliminate even minimal distortions.

Pay attention to the opening system. The doors of a built-in refrigerator are often equipped with a mechanism Door-on-Door (door on the door) or Sliding Door (sliding door). In the first case, the facade is rigidly fixed to the refrigerator door and moves with it. In the second, the facade is attached to the cabinet body, and the refrigerator door slides inside. The installation mechanism for these systems is radically different.

Final setup and performance check

After all the fasteners are tightened and the facades are aligned, it is time for the final tests. Plug in the refrigerator. Pay attention to the indicators: they should light up and the compressor should start after a while (the delay is needed to protect against frequent starts).

Check the tightness of the doors. There should be no gaps between the seal and the housing through which the cold escapes. If the door does not fit tightly, the striker plate or the hinges themselves may need adjustment. Also check the operation of the closers, if they are provided for by the model.

Leave the refrigerator idle for at least 2-3 hours before loading food. This will allow the system to reach operating temperature conditions and stabilize. At this time, listen to the operation of the unit: extraneous knocking, rattling or excessive hum may indicate that the refrigerator is touching the walls of a niche or furniture.

Frequent errors and troubleshooting

Even experienced professionals sometimes make mistakes that can be costly. One of the most common problems is insufficient ventilation. If you feel that the back wall of the cabinet or the base is very hot, it means that the air channels are blocked or dirty.

Another common mistake is incorrect calculation of the height of the facade. If the facade is too long, it will touch the floor when opening; if it’s short, an unsightly gap will form. Always do a fitting before final fastening. They also often forget to remove the shipping bolts from the compressor (if any), which leads to vibration and noise.

Is it possible to install a built-in refrigerator in a regular one? wardrobe?

Technically possible, but highly not recommended without modification. A regular cabinet does not have the necessary ventilation system (vents in the base and on top), which will lead to overheating. Also, the walls of a regular cabinet may not withstand weight and vibration.

What to do if the front panel is heavier than recommended?

Using a facade that is too heavy will lead to rapid wear of the hinges and the door not closing tightly. In this case, it is necessary to replace standard hinges with reinforced ones or use a lighter material for the facade (for example, MDF instead of solid wood).

Do you need to drill holes in the back wall of the cabinet?

Yes, in most cases this is necessary to ensure air circulation. However, the size and location of the holes depend on the specific refrigerator model. Typically, a hole with a diameter of 40-50 mm is required in the rear wall of the cabinet at the level of the compressor.

How to hide the gap between the refrigerator and the countertop?

If the gap remains due to different heights, you can use a decorative strip (base) or order a front panel taking into account the margin. In some cases, adjusting the legs of the refrigerator itself helps if the design allows it to be raised higher.
